INSIDE THE REAL WWII BUNKER
Visit the Berlin Story Bunker and explore one of Berlin’s most powerful exhibitions about World War II and Hitler’s rise to power. Inside this real air-raid shelter from 1942, you’ll walk through the exhibition “Hitler – How Could It Happen?”. The exhibition is spread across 3,000 square meters and three floors. With 38 sections, photos, films, and real stories, this exhibition helps you understand one of the darkest times in history. Discover how the Nazi Party rose to power and used propaganda to shape people’s beliefs. See the story of Hitler’s last days in the Führerbunker and learn how the Holocaust changed history forever. FÜHRERBUNKER
See the only existing 1:25 scale model of the Führerbunker, created by film designer Monika Bauert after detailed historical research. Discover where Hitler spent his final days before taking his own life on April 30, 1945, marking the end of World War II.

Interesting facts about Hitler’s Führerbunker
DEEPER THAN YOU THINK
The Führerbunker was about 8 meters underground. It was built beneath the Reich Chancellery garden with two separate levels, an upper Vorbunker and a deeper main bunker.
LAST DAYS OF THE REGIME
Hitler spent his final 105 days there, from January to April 1945, as Soviet forces surrounded Berlin.
DESTROYED, BUT NOT COMPLETELY
After the war, the Soviets tried to blow it up several times. However, some parts of the bunker proved too strong to destroy completely. Some sections still exist underground but remain inaccessible.
HIDDEN IN PLAIN SIGHT
The original bunker site is today a parking lot near Potsdamer Platz. It is marked only by a small informational sign installed in 2006. Many visitors pass by without realizing what lies beneath.

How to get to the Berlin Story Bunker?
- S-Bahn: S1, S2, S25, S26 - Anhalter Bahnhof station
- U-Bahn: U1, U3, U7 - Möckernbrücke station; or U1, U2, U3 - Gleisdreieck station
- Bus: M29 - Schöneberger Brücke stop; N1 - U Möckernbrücke stop
